Diagram (A) depicts limbs that evolved from the front limbs of a common ancestor whose bones resembled those of an ancient fish. If these animals had no recent common ancestor, they would be unlikely to share so many common structures. Similarly, a bird’s wing and a horse’s front limb have similar structures and
development, but different functions.
Diagram (B) depicts the wings of a butterfly and the wings of a bat. Although they have
similar functions, they don’t have similar bone structures. (15.1)
